Market Overview

The global generative AI in packaging market refers to the deployment of generative artificial intelligence models that autonomously create, optimize, and personalize packaging designs, structures, graphics, and material configurations by analyzing parameters for functionality, sustainability, and consumer appeal. The solutions enable automatic structural design and quick prototype development, and creation of personalized artwork and product labels and lightweight product design, recycling process optimization and supply chain management efficiency for food and beverage and online retail, beauty and pharmaceutical and consumer packaged goods industries.
